免费使用

苹果证书一键在线制作,工具完全免费:测试证书、ADHOC证书、上架证书、推送证书、P12证书、P8证书一键生成

苹果证书创建

苹果证书创建是指在苹果开发者中心创建用于发布应用程序或进行设备管理的数字证书。苹果证书是由苹果公司签发的数字证书,用于验证应用程序和设备的身份和安全性。在进行应用程序开发和发布时,需要创建苹果证书来对应用程序进行签名,以确保应用程序的安全性和完整性。下面将介绍苹果证书的创建原理和详细步骤。

苹果证书创建的原理是基于公钥加密技术。公钥加密技术是一种利用非对称密钥加密算法的加密方法。它使用一对密钥,即公钥和私钥,来进行加密和解密操作。公钥是公开的,任何人都可以获得,用于加密数据。私钥则是保密的,只有持有私钥的人才能解密数据。在苹果证书创建过程中,开发者需要生成一对公钥和私钥,将公钥提交给苹果开发者中心,由苹果公司签发数字证书并返回给开发者使用。

苹果证书创建的详细步骤如下:

1. 登录苹果开发者中心,选择“证书、标识和配置文件”菜单,点击“证书”选项卡。

2. 点击“添加证书”按钮,选择需要创建的证书类型,如开发证书或发布证书。

3. 选择证书的使用范围,如用于开发应用程序或用于管理设备。

4. 选择证书的名称和描述,输入相关信息,并上传证书签名请求文件(Certificate Signing Request,简称CSR)。

5. 等待苹果公司审核,审核通过后,将会生成一个证书文件,可以下载并安装到本地电脑中。

6. 在Xcode中使用证书进行应用程序的签名和发布。

7. 在设备管理中使用证书进行设备的管理和分发。

总之,苹果证书创建是开发者在苹果开发者中心创建用于发布应用程序或进行设备管理的数字证书的过程,利用公钥加密技术生成一对公钥和私钥,将公钥提交给苹果公司签发数字证书并返回给开发者使用。创建苹果证书是确保应用程序和设备安全性和完整性的重要步骤。


相关知识:
苹果证书掉了
苹果证书掉了,通常指的是iOS设备上的应用程序无法正常运行,因为它们依赖于苹果开发者证书来验证其身份。如果证书失效或被撤销,应用程序将无法启动或崩溃。苹果开发者证书是一种数字证书,用于验证应用程序的身份和来源。开发者必须先向苹果申请证书,然后使用它来签署他
2023-04-07
苹果证书信任公司
苹果证书信任公司(Apple Certificate Authority)是苹果公司旗下的一个证书颁发机构,它负责颁发和管理苹果设备上使用的数字证书。这些证书被用于加密和认证数据传输,以及确保设备和应用程序的安全性。苹果证书信任公司的证书被广泛应用于苹果设
2023-04-07
苹果拦截证书安装
苹果拦截证书安装是苹果公司为了保证设备安全性所做的一种措施。通过拦截证书安装,苹果公司可以防止用户安装未经过苹果认证的应用程序和软件,从而保护了用户的设备安全。本文将对苹果拦截证书安装的原理和详细介绍进行阐述。一、苹果拦截证书安装的原理苹果拦截证书安装的原
2023-04-07
苹果怎么卸载未签名的软件
苹果设备的安全性一直以来都备受关注,因此苹果公司为了保护用户的隐私和安全,对于未经过签名的软件进行了限制。在苹果设备上卸载未签名的软件比较简单,下面我将为大家介绍其原理和详细操作步骤。一、原理:苹果设备上的软件都需要经过苹果公司的签名认证,只有经过认证的软
2023-04-07
苹果ipa个人签名
苹果ipa个人签名是一种在iOS设备上安装未经过苹果官方认证的第三方应用程序的方法。这种方法可以让用户在不越狱的情况下安装自己喜欢的应用程序,同时也能够保证应用程序的安全性。本文将详细介绍苹果ipa个人签名的原理和步骤。一、苹果ipa个人签名的原理苹果ip
2023-04-07
苹果id证书满了
在使用苹果设备时,我们需要使用苹果ID登录,以便使用App Store、iCloud等服务。每个苹果ID都有一个证书,用于验证用户的身份和授权使用服务。然而,有时候我们会遇到苹果ID证书满了的问题,这个问题是什么原因引起的呢?苹果ID证书满了的原因是因为苹
2023-04-07
ios开发者怎么导出证书描述文件
iOS开发者在进行应用程序的发布时需要使用证书和描述文件,这两个文件可以用于应用程序的签名和验证。证书和描述文件是苹果公司提供的,只有在开发者中心中申请并下载后才能使用。本文将介绍如何导出iOS开发者证书和描述文件。首先,需要在苹果开发者中心中创建开发者证
2023-04-07
ios开发免证书真机调试
在iOS开发中,要在真机上进行调试需要使用证书进行签名,这对于新手来说是一件很麻烦的事情。但是,有一种方法可以让你在不使用证书的情况下进行真机调试。这种方法称为“免证书真机调试”。原理:免证书真机调试的原理是利用苹果公司提供的一个叫做“企业级证书”的东西。
2023-04-07
ios创建推送证书和描述文件
在iOS开发中,推送服务是一项非常重要的功能。为了使用推送服务,我们需要创建一个推送证书和描述文件。本文将为大家介绍如何创建推送证书和描述文件以及其原理。一、什么是推送证书和描述文件?推送证书是一种数字证书,用于验证推送服务的身份。描述文件是一个包含应用程
2023-04-07
ios10信用证书
iOS10信用证书,也称为数字证书,是一种数字化的身份证明,用于验证用户身份和授权访问网络资源。它采用了公钥加密技术,确保了传输数据的安全性和完整性。本文将介绍iOS10信用证书的原理和详细信息。一、iOS10信用证书的原理iOS10信用证书是基于公钥加密
2023-04-07
ios 签名修复
iOS 签名修复是指通过某些手段修复被篡改的 iOS 应用程序的签名,以达到正常运行的目的。在 iOS 中,每个应用程序都必须进行数字签名,以确保应用程序的完整性和可信度。但是,黑客通过对应用程序进行篡改,使得应用程序的签名变得无效,导致应用程序无法正常运
2023-04-07
ios 免证书
iOS 免证书是指在不需要安装任何开发者证书的情况下,将自己的应用程序安装到 iOS 设备上。这种方法不需要使用 Apple 的开发者账号和证书,使得开发者可以更加便捷地在自己的设备上调试和测试应用程序。下面将对 iOS 免证书的原理进行详细介绍。首先需要
2023-04-07
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4